SCIENTIFIC ASPECTS OF PATIENT REHABILITATION AFTER STROKE. REVIEW LITERATURE.
Introduction. Cardiovascular diseases (CVD) occupy a stable leading position among the causes of mortality in most countries of the world, including Kazakhstan. According to the information from the state collection "Natural movement of the Population of the Republic of Kazakhstan" for January-December 2020, the Bureau of National Statistics of the Agency for Strategic Planning and Reforms of the Republic of Kazakhstan, among the causes of mortality in the first place is mortality due to diseases of the circulatory system (36.6 thousand people). It accounts for 22% of the total mortality. In comparison with 2019, the number of deaths from heart attacks, strokes, coronary heart disease, angina increased by 6.3 thousand (+ 20.6%). Rehabilitation of patients at the stage of residual stroke phenomena is not given much importance, since it is believed that the recovery processes have already been completed by this period. However, there are scientific data indicating that rehabilitation measures are sufficiently effective in patients who had a stroke 2 years ago or more, provided that rehabilitation measures are used as actively as in the acute and early recovery periods of stroke [43]. The purpose of the study: To analyze the literature data on the rehabilitation of patients of working age after a stroke. Search strategy: The study examined full-text publications in English and Russian, which are devoted to the rehabilitation of patients of working age after a stroke. In the process of literature search, the following search engines were used: Pubmed, Web of science, Cyberleninka, Google Scholar by keywords cardiovascular disease, stroke, mortality, disability, rehabilitation, rehabilitation organization. The time period was designated 2011-2021. 956 publications have been identified on this topic. Of these, 43 publications corresponded to the purpose of our study. Results and conclusions. Numerous publications show that, unfortunately, at the present stage there are not enough organizational measures that would improve the health indicators of stroke patients, improve the quality of life, and reduce disability.
